Аннотация.
Оптимизация алгоритмов вычислений значений многочленов, точнее мономов, эквивалентна задаче построения для заданного числа минимальной аддитивной цепочки. Для поиска таких цепочек не известно никаких алгоритмов, кроме перебора. Рост сложности перебора очень велик. Среди цепочек одинаковой длины очень много эквивалентных, то есть заканчивающихся одинаковым числом. В статье приведен достаточный признак эквивалентности цепочек и показано, как использование признака позволяет сократить процедуру формирования всех аддитивных цепочек фиксированной длины.

3.3. Структура программы перебора.
ЦИКЛ-1.
В цикле меняется номер цепочки п от 1 до (п - 1)!, по списку ListPrizn проверяем, не попала ли эта цепочка в класс эквивалентных цепочек, рассмотренных ранее. Если «да», то переходим к следующему номеру (основной момент экономии). Если «нет», то число п преобразуется в соответствующий набор индексов {r1,...,rт), и цепочка восстанавливается. Если в списке List позиция с номером ст не заполнена, то заносим туда цепочку и в такую же позицию списка ListW заносим номер этой цепочки. Если в списке List позиция с номером ст уже заполнена, то в позицию ст списка ListW добавляем очередной номер цепочки.
Бесплатно скачать электронную книгу в удобном формате, смотреть и читать:
Скачать книгу Компьютерные инструменты в образовании, 2020 - fileskachat.com, быстрое и бесплатное скачивание.
Скачать pdf
Ниже можно купить эту книгу, если она есть в продаже, и похожие книги по лучшей цене со скидкой с доставкой по всей России.Купить книги
Скачать - pdf - Яндекс.Диск.
Теги: 2020 :: компьютер :: инструмент